Abstract
Compressing files is disclosed. An input file to be compressed is first aligned. Aligning the file includes splitting the file into sequences that can be aligned. When splitting the file into sequences or when performing subsequent recursive splitting, the splitting is based on a longest sequence match. The result is a compression matrix, where each row of the matrix corresponds to part of the file. A consensus sequence is determined from the compression matrix. Using the consensus sequence, pointer pairs are generated. Each pointer pair identifies a subsequence of the consensus matrix. The compressed file includes the pointer pairs and the consensus sequence.
